Juventus officially announced that it had signed a contract with 2008 youth goalkeeper Rafael Huli for three years.
Juventus Club issued an announcement on its official website stating: "Raphael Huli has signed his first professional contract, which expires on June 30, 2028. Congratulations, Rafael!"
Rafael Huli was born in July 2008. He entered Juventus youth training in 2017. Last season, he was the main goalkeeper of Juventus U17 team and reached the league semi-finals with the team. Rafael Huli also represented Albania in the U17 European Cup this summer.
